some background my approach for other traders. below is an updated algo chart. PM me for join.me log in. its runs 24/5

Rules or underpinnings of algos.
There is no magic way that works all the time
Its easier to be 50/50 than 80/20
Loses are necessary evil of risk management
Algo diversification – styles and trend direction
** KEY** Trade when algo is working , off when not

Percieved Edge
-faster execution
-Track more instruments
-Fewer errors
-emotionless

8 different Aglos, 4 EURUSD and 4 USDJPY
1 Bi-directional trend model – long short looking for trends
1 Bi-directional Chop model – long short look for periods of Chop
Long only model - only takes long – rationale based on 2D modeling
Short Only Model – only takes short

2D Modeling – this s where algo code comes into play. Instead of trading the original trading system signal, we analyze the equity curve and trade based on that – 2d = Second derivative

Money Management = $150-300 per trade risk
Risk budget = $6-8k - a little out of TST but risk peanute, make peanuts
Max Position = 3 & 3 for approx. 20k margin
